3 minute bread recipe details
Ingredients
500 g spelt flour or whole wheat flour, or a mixture of both |
1 packet(s) dry yeast |
450 ml warm water |
50 g sun flower seeds (or other seeds) |
50 g sesame |
50 g linseed |
2 tsp salt |
2 tbsp fruit vinegar |
Instructions
Dissolve the yeast in warm water.
Mix together the flour, seeds, salt and vinegar. Add the yeast water and mix well. Do not knead and do not leave it to rise.
Fill everything into a loaf pan and put it in the cold oven. Turn on the oven and set it at 200°C. Bake for 1 hour. Take it out of the loaf pan and bake it for another 10 minutes if necessary.
If you want your crust a bit softer, wet a kitchen towel and cover the bread with it right after it comes out of the oven. Leave it like that for about 15 minutes.
Preparation time:
ca. 3 min
Grade of difficulty:
easy
